Safety
Many people are concerned about the safety of bunk bed near me beds, but an analysis from the past shows that this kind of bed is not so dangerous as some believe. While the research shows that many injuries occur from falls, they aren't often serious enough to warrant immediate medical attention.
Discuss with your children the bunk bed safety rules. This will allow them to avoid injuries and also use the beds safely. The most frequent bunk bed-related injuries include bumps, bruises, cuts and broken bones.
The most important thing to remember for bunk bed safety is to make sure that the top bunk is adorned with guardrails. These rails should rise at least five inches higher than the mattress, with an opening no wider than fifteen inches. They should also be secured to the bed using fasteners that have to be released before they can be removed, and the tops of the rails should not be lower than five inches above the mattress foundation.
Another crucial bunk bed safety tip is to ensure that there aren't any gaps or holes in the bed that might allow children to fall or get trapped. These can be as simple as holes on the sides or top of the bed, or as complex as a hole between the two walls.
It can be dangerous to climb up and down the ladder in the dark. Installing a nightlight in the area of the ladder will ensure it is safer. It could be powered by batteries or wired in, depending on the arrangement. It's an excellent way to keep children safe while trying to climb up and down from the top bunk.
Other bunk bed safety tips include limiting the number of people sleeping in the bunk beds price beds to one person and removing all personal belongings from the area around the bed. The hanging of belts, scarves or jump ropes hanging on the bed could be very dangerous and could cause strangulation.
The room your child is in should have a light for night so that they can use the bathroom in the middle night. This will allow them to navigate in the dark and avoid becoming lost or injuring yourself.
